I took a turn Hid from your face thought I was walking at a forward pace
They asked if I believed in you I denied I'm stuck like glue wanting the other side
my lifes a mess the last thing I want to do is confess what all I did do Even if it was just to you and no one else
because I'm stubborn and selfish and think I'm 'bright' even though deep inside your the only One who's right but I still have to fight I cant let go of this thing that bleeds down inside of me
Not alone I need to be set free And You're the only one who can Wash me, clense me with Your hands Clean in between the bends That have been infected in my heart I don't think it will help too much, but even so, It's a start
